Abstract

Based on 1,3,3,5,5-penta[1-(2,2-dimethyl-1,3-dioxolan-4-yl)methoxy]-1-chlorocyclotriphosphazene, a series of hybrid compounds was obtained by two-step synthesis. In the molecules of the compounds obtained, hydrophobic organic residues are attached to the cyclotriphosphazene nucleus via a linker. A dialkyl substituted 1,2,3-triazole synthesized by click-chemistry methodology from acetylenic cyclotriphosphazene derivatives and organic azides in the presence of Cu(I) can be used as a linker connecting pentadioxolane-substituted phosphazene core. The reaction proceeds regioselectively with the formation of 1,4-disubstituted 1,2,3-triazoles only.
